Output 38e63178b2dfc5aa42d9dec5060586a22221ba104d57674cf2a628ecd0a1aef5:3

value
5002420
script pubkey
OP_0 OP_PUSHBYTES_20 7aa135bf38b81788a368b30aae95c2e9a6a98612
address
bc1q02snt0echqtc3gmgkv92a9wzaxn2npsj82t0q9
transaction
38e63178b2dfc5aa42d9dec5060586a22221ba104d57674cf2a628ecd0a1aef5
spent
true